The “Basic Plan” is the most affordable option offered by Delta Dental in Colorado. No deductible is charged, but there is a copayment of $15 for every office visit. The plan maximum is $1,000 per individual per year. Preventive care, fillings, and non-surgical extractions are fully covered.

In most cases, health insurance is provided by your employer, although you usually have to pa...This is the benchmark health insurance plan for health plans for 2023 and beyond. It went into effect on January 1, 2023. In 2021, the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) approved Colorado's benchmark plan to start in the 2023 plan year. Oct. 12, 2021 CMS Letter Approving Colorado's EHB-Benchmark Plan; DOI News Release - …New Customers. Navigate life’s twists and turns with health insurance. We are now open for you to get health coverage for 2024. Open Enrollment (November 1-January 15 is the time when almost all Coloradans can buy private health insurance plans. Coloradans who experience a Qualifying Life Change Event outside of Open Enrollment have a 60-day ...

The number of individual plans available across the state ...Connect for Health Colorado is the only place you can apply for financial help to lower the cost of private health insurance. The financial help you can get to lower your monthly payment is called a Premium Tax Credit. Get help completing the application process from Connect for Health Colorado’s state-wide network of certified experts.
